High-pressure Mössbauer studies of amorphous and crystallineFe3B and(Fe0.25Ni0.75)3B

Abstract
The pressure dependence of the Fe57 hyperfine parameters in amorphous and crystalline (Fe1xNix)3B alloys (x=0 and 0.75) were measured by Mössbauer spectroscopy. A similar response of all hyperfine parameters for both the amorphous and crystalline phases with decreasing volume was observed. The pressure dependence of the hyperfine field indicates that the distribution of Fe-B interatomic distances is about two times narrower than that of the Fe-Fe interatomic distances measured by x-ray scattering.
